#1d2d17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d2d17 is composed of 11.4% red, 17.6%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.9% yellow and 82.4% black. It has a hue angle of 103.6 degrees, a saturation of 32.4% and a lightness of 13.3%. #1d2d17 color hex could be obtained by blending #3a5a2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#1d2d17 color description : Very dark (mostly black) green.
#1d2d17 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d2d17 has RGB values of R:29, G:45,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 1912087.
